Output 589b05118ffaa3027fa15238a933d0b8932f64ba3550f589ffd87f9422128267:46

value
3096640
script pubkey
OP_0 OP_PUSHBYTES_20 d7b3b81f9dcceb291efafc6ecddc4e2d86ec9c56
address
bc1q67ems8uaen4jj8h6l3hvmhzw9krwe8zkrxezgy
transaction
589b05118ffaa3027fa15238a933d0b8932f64ba3550f589ffd87f9422128267
spent
true